TT - The Geography Book


The Geography Book
Activities for exploring, mapping and enjoying your world
  • Format: Paper back / Hardback
  • Number of Pages: 112 
  • Publisher: John Wiley & Sons Inc 
  • Publication Date: 
  • ISBN 10: 0471412368 
  • ISBN 13: 9780471412366  
  • Author: Caroline Arnold 
  • Illustrator
I am very impressed with this book.  It is neatly organized and well presented with plenty of hands on activity to help students practically understand what they are learning. It's a great read aloud and the lessons build upon one another. The book has an extensive index and glossary following it's 38 lessons.

TT - Charlotte Mason's Elementary Geography


Charlotte Mason's Elementary Geography
  • Format: Paper back / eBook
  • Number of Pages: 68
  • Vendor: Queen Homeschool Supplies
  • Publication Date: 2008
  • ISBN: 
  • Author:  Charlotte Mason
  • Revised by: Sandi Queen
  • Illustrator
Last year I decided to search out for Charlotte Mason geography resources and discovered that Charlotte Mason had written a geography book.  On my travels to search out this book I discovered it online and then to my delight found the Queen Homeschool Supplies had revised it and they were now publishing the book.  Unfortunately I could not purchase it here in Australia. I recently discovered that it is now being offered as an eBook

The book contains 41 lessons and are written in narrative form.  There are illustrations, poems and some lessons are complete with mapping assignments.
